Level 1 AI Foundations 

An introductory stage providing essential knowledge of Artificial Intelligence, digital technologies, ethics, and future career opportunities.

Level 2 AI Practitioner Apprentice

A practical apprenticeship level focused on applying AI tools, techniques, and workplace skills in real-world environments.

Level 3  Certified AI Professional 

Professional certification recognising competence in AI implementation, responsible practice, and industry-standard skills.

Level 4 AI Specialist / Industry Placement

Advanced training and workplace experience that develops specialist expertise in AI applications, innovation, and sector-specific solutions.

Level 5 Chartered AI Professional (Future Goal)

The highest level of professional recognition, representing leadership, strategic capability, ethical responsibility, and significant contribution to the AI profession.

Cybersecurity Career Pathways

Cybersecurity professionals are in high demand across government, finance, healthcare, education, defence and the private sector. Our cybersecurity apprenticeships provide learners with practical experience, industry knowledge and recognised qualifications that support long-term cybersecurity career pathways.

Training includes:

  • Cybersecurity fundamentals

  • Information security

  • Network security

  • Cyber risk management

  • Digital resilience

  • Incident response

  • Cloud security

  • Data protection

  • Cybersecurity awareness

  • Security best practices

These programmes prepare learners for roles such as Cybersecurity Analyst, Security Operations Centre (SOC) Analyst, Information Security Officer, IT Security Consultant and Digital Risk Specialist.
